什么是Tokenim接口?

最近常有人问我,Tokenim到底是个什么神奇的东西?其实它就是一个用于创建和管理区块链代币的接口。听起来好像很高大上,但实际上,它就是让我们在区块链网络中发数字货币的一种工具。用普通话说,就是通过Tokenim,我们可以申请创建自己的代币、管理这些代币的流通和交易。简单点说,就是给你的数字资源加上一个标签,让它在区块链上合法存在。

为什么要开发Tokenim接口?

为什么那么多人愿意花时间和精力去研究和开发Tokenim接口呢?要知道,区块链的蓬勃发展,让越来越多的企业和个人开始重视数字货币这个蓝海市场。比如说,最近某个知名品牌推出了自己的数字货币,通过Tokenim接口,让他们的忠实客户能以此换取一些独特的权益。这种用户体验,是他们传统营销手段所无法比拟的。

如何入手Tokenim接口开发?

说到开发,其实第一步就是要了解开发环境。通常需要一些基础的编程知识,例如JavaScript或Python,这些语言在区块链开发中都比较常见。我记得第一次尝试开发的时候,自学的过程中真是摔了不少跟头。特别是在选择开发框架时,市面上有太多的选择。例如,使用以太坊的开发工具Truffle,可以让开发过程更顺畅。当然,首先得在以太坊上创建和设置一个钱包,才有可能进行后续的开发操作。

实际开发步骤

说到实际操作,首先得了解Tokenim接口的基本功能和实现逻辑。大家都知道,代币有不同类型,比如ERC20或ERC721。有些是可替代的,有些则是不可替代的,具体选择哪种类型,得看你的需求。我自己在开发的时候,就碰到过选择代币类型的问题,最后经过反复琢磨,决定选用ERC20。

创建代币的具体步骤

下面我简单介绍一下创建代币的步骤。首先,你需要创建一个智能合约。这听起来比较复杂,但其实是个很简单的过程。你只需编写一些基础的代码,让代币具备基本的属性,比如名称、符号、总供应量等等。以我自己的经验来说,写代码的时候要注意些细节,例如小数点位数、总量的设置,这些都影响后续的使用。

测试和部署你的代币

搞定代码后,别急着部署,首先要进行测试!测试网络是个神奇的地方,你可以在这里免费尝试,直到没问题为止。比如,你可以用Rinkeby测试网来进行这些操作。测试没有问题后,才可以把合约部署到主网上。我当时也是在Rinkeby上测试了一段时间,调整了几次,直到最后可以在主网上顺利发布。

如何使用Tokenim接口

这一块其实是最有趣的。当你创建好代币后,就可以通过Tokenim接口开始进行各种操作,比如获取代币余额、转账、铸币等等。这一切都通过一套API进行操作。大多数开发者在这方面可能会遇到挑战,特别是在调用接口时,如果不熟悉API文档,可能会走很多弯路。我自己也曾经因为不理解接口的返回值,搞得一头雾水,最后还是借助社区的力量才搞懂的。

如何处理错误和调试

话说回来,错误是程序员的老朋友,在开发Tokenim接口的时候,调试是必不可少的。我记得之前碰到过一个合约部署后的返回值不对,折腾了半天才发现是因为一次简单的数据类型冲突。遇到这种情况,首先可以通过常用的调试工具,比如Remix来查看问题。慢慢积累经验,调试能力会越来越强。每次解决一个问题,都会有一种成就感,让人欲罢不能。

成功的经验分享

说实话,开发Tokenim接口的过程不会一帆风顺,但每当解决一个难题时,那种欣喜是无法用言语表达的。记得有次我在一次开发大赛中用自己开发的代币参与,最后还拿了个小奖。那个时候觉得,自己之前的努力真的没白费,所有的学习和尝试都值得。

区块链未来的发展方向

在谈到Tokenim接口时,自然不能不提区块链的未来。数字货币的普及和区块链技术的发展正以不可阻挡的势头推进。说不定哪天,你的朋友也会像用支付宝一样,轻松使用数字货币。我听说有些企业甚至开始研究如何将区块链整合入他们的供应链管理中,充分利用透明和不可篡改的特性。试想一下,将来也许我们可以买到的每一件商品,都能在区块链上追溯历史,这无疑是个革命性的进步。

结语

无论是刚接触开发的初学者,还是已经有一定经验的老鸟,Tokenim接口的开发都是一个有趣且富有挑战性的旅程。希望我分享的这些经历,能对你们有所帮助。谁知道呢,也许你下一个开发的代币就是下一个“比特币”。总之,加油吧!